O que é: Network Automation
Network Automation, ou automação de redes, refere-se ao uso de tecnologia para automatizar tarefas e processos relacionados à gestão de redes de computadores. Essa prática é essencial para aumentar a eficiência operacional, reduzir erros humanos e melhorar a agilidade na implementação de mudanças. Com a crescente complexidade das infraestruturas de TI, a automação de redes se tornou uma necessidade crítica para empresas que buscam otimizar seus recursos e garantir um desempenho consistente.
História e Origem
A automação de redes começou a ganhar destaque na década de 1990, com o advento de tecnologias de gerenciamento de redes. Inicialmente, as ferramentas eram limitadas e focadas em tarefas específicas, como monitoramento e configuração de dispositivos. Com o avanço da tecnologia, especialmente com a introdução de protocolos como SNMP (Simple Network Management Protocol), as soluções de automação se tornaram mais robustas e integradas. Nos anos 2000, a necessidade de maior eficiência levou ao desenvolvimento de plataformas de automação que permitiram a orquestração de processos complexos, estabelecendo as bases para o que conhecemos hoje como Network Automation.
Definição Completa
Network Automation é um conjunto de ferramentas e processos que permitem a configuração, gerenciamento e operação de redes de forma automatizada. Isso inclui a implementação de políticas de rede, monitoramento de desempenho, provisionamento de dispositivos e resposta a incidentes, tudo sem a necessidade de intervenção manual. A automação pode ser aplicada a diversas camadas da rede, desde a infraestrutura física até os serviços de aplicação, permitindo uma gestão mais eficiente e menos propensa a erros. O uso de scripts, APIs e software de gerenciamento é comum para facilitar essas operações.
Exemplos de Uso
Um exemplo prático de Network Automation é a configuração automática de roteadores e switches em uma nova filial de uma empresa. Em vez de configurar cada dispositivo manualmente, um administrador pode usar uma ferramenta de automação para aplicar configurações padrão em todos os dispositivos simultaneamente. Outro exemplo é o monitoramento de tráfego de rede, onde ferramentas automatizadas podem identificar anomalias e gerar alertas em tempo real, permitindo uma resposta rápida a possíveis problemas de segurança ou desempenho.
Aplicações e Importância
A automação de redes é aplicada em diversas áreas, incluindo data centers, provedores de serviços de internet e ambientes corporativos. Sua importância reside na capacidade de reduzir custos operacionais, aumentar a eficiência e melhorar a segurança da rede. Com a automação, as organizações podem implementar mudanças rapidamente, escalar suas operações de forma eficiente e garantir a conformidade com políticas de segurança. Além disso, a automação permite que as equipes de TI se concentrem em tarefas mais estratégicas, em vez de se perderem em atividades repetitivas e manuais.
Recursos Adicionais
Para aqueles que desejam se aprofundar no tema, existem diversos recursos disponíveis, como cursos online, webinars e livros especializados em automação de redes. Plataformas como Cisco, Juniper e VMware oferecem treinamentos e certificações que podem ajudar profissionais a se tornarem proficientes em Network Automation. Além disso, comunidades online e fóruns são ótimos locais para trocar experiências e obter dicas sobre as melhores práticas e ferramentas disponíveis no mercado.
Perguntas Frequentes
1. O que é Network Automation?
Network Automation é o uso de tecnologia para automatizar a configuração, gerenciamento e operação de redes de computadores.
2. Quais são os benefícios da automação de redes?
Os principais benefícios incluem redução de erros humanos, aumento da eficiência operacional e agilidade na implementação de mudanças.
3. Quais ferramentas são usadas para Network Automation?
Ferramentas populares incluem Ansible, Puppet, Chef e plataformas específicas de fornecedores como Cisco e Juniper.
4. A automação de redes é segura?
Sim, quando implementada corretamente, a automação pode melhorar a segurança da rede ao permitir monitoramento e resposta rápida a incidentes.
5. Como posso começar a aprender sobre Network Automation?
Você pode começar com cursos online, tutoriais em vídeo e documentação de ferramentas específicas de automação.